ABSTRACT:
A semiconductor storage device having a plurality of banks therein, includes a main drive circuit (hereinafter referred to as a main SAPN circuit), provided for each bank, for driving a sense amplifier and an auxiliary drive circuit (hereinafter referred to as a sub-SAPN circuit) for holding electric potential after driving the sense amplifier. The main SAPN circuit of each bank is commonly connected to a VDD wiring and a GND wiring (hereinafter referred to as a main power-supply wiring), the sub-SAPN circuit of each bank is connected to each of the VDD wiring and the GND wiring which are provided for each bank and smaller in capacity than the main power-supply wiring, and after completion of a sensing operation by the sense amplifier of each bank, only the sub-SAPN circuit is set in an active state to hold electric potential of the sense amplifier.
